CVE-2025-49652 is a critical-severity vulnerability rated 9.8/10 on the CVSS scale. Missing Authentication in the registration feature of Lablup's BackendAI allows arbitrary users to create user accounts that can access private data even when registration is disabled.. EPSS estimates a 0.38%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
